‘Ra.One’ animator seriously injured in road mishap

`Ra.One` animator seriously injured in road mishap One of the important thing members of the animation team that added the lighting tricks in Bollywood actor Shah Rukh Khan starrer film 'Ra. One', Charu Khandal was seriously injured when the automobile rickshaw wherein she was travelling was hammered by a speeding Honda City car within the wee hours of Sunday at Mumbai's Oshiwara area.

The accident occurred at around 1 am on Sunday, media reports said.

National Award winning Khandal, who's now battling for life, was returning home along with her sister Ritu and friend Vikrant Goyal.

The 28-year-old animator has reportedly suffered multiple fractures in her legs and spine.

The swelling in her spinal cord is preventing doctors from conducting any surgery, reports said.

According to reports, Khandal's sister and friend also suffered from serious injuries. Khandal and others were taken to a personal medical facility immediately after the accident.

Manoj Kumar Gautam was reportedly driving the Honda City car in a drunken state. The police arrested him on Sunday for rash and negligent driving. He was later granted bail by the vacation Court.

Meanwhile, the Bollywood fraternity is concerned over the injury of Charu Khandal. Anubhav Sinha, director of Ra.One, said he was extremely saddened by the incident.
